Originally Posted by Barkinpark
I bank my OW miles with AS and should make MVP Gold (Sapphire) next year.

On the other hand, I would like to convert some Capital One miles to Cathay Pacific's FFP so that I can redeem an econ flight in 2024 from Vietnam to HKG. In this case, assuming I really make Sapphire, will I be able to get extra check-in baggage allowance for this flight? I know that the benefit holds for purchased (in cash) flights, but am not sure if it extends to mileage tickets.

Thanks.
You can get the confirmation you need at https://www.cathaypacific.com/cx/en_US/baggage.html, by selecting oneworld sapphire and redemption. When you redeem your ticket with CX, you can also ask them to add your AS number (while keeping your CX number as FQTR, R for redemption).
